Description

Sweater pressing and ironing device
Technical Field
The utility model relates to the technical field of knitting processing equipment, in particular to a knitting pressing and ironing device.
Background
The knitted sweater is a technological product which is knitted by knitting needles and is formed by knitting various raw materials and varieties of yarns into loops and connecting the loops into a knitted fabric through a string sleeve. The knitted sweater has soft texture, good wrinkle resistance and air permeability, high extensibility and elasticity, and is comfortable to wear, and the knitted sweater needs to be pressed and shaped in the production and processing process.
In the prior art, patent document with bulletin number of CN216514668U discloses a sweater pressing and ironing device, which comprises an installation table, a base, a stepping driving structure, a driving machine, a T-shaped frame, an installation seat, a pressing and ironing roller, a workbench and a position adjusting mechanism, wherein the installation table is arranged at the upper end of the base, the stepping driving structure is arranged on the installation table, the driving machine is used for driving the stepping driving structure to operate, the T-shaped frame is driven by the stepping driving structure to reciprocate back and forth, the installation seat is fixedly connected with the T-shaped frame, the pressing and ironing roller is rotationally connected at the bottom of the installation seat, the workbench is positioned inside the installation table, and the position adjusting mechanism is positioned inside the base and used for adjusting the height of the workbench.
In the use process, the device can not fix the knitted sweater, so that the knitted sweater deviates in the ironing process, and the ironing and shaping effects are poor.
Disclosure of Invention
In order to solve the technical problems, the utility model provides a sweater pressing and ironing device for improving the fixation of a sweater.
The utility model relates to a sweater pressing and ironing device, which comprises an ironing table and supporting legs, wherein the supporting legs are arranged at the bottom end of the ironing table, and the sweater pressing and ironing device also comprises a fixed supporting component and a pressing and ironing component, wherein the fixed supporting component and the pressing and ironing component are both arranged at the top end of the ironing table, the fixed supporting component supports and fixes a sweater from the inside of the sweater, and the pressing and ironing component presses and shapes the sweater; when the ironing device is used, the knitted sweater is sleeved on the fixed supporting component, the fixed supporting component is used for supporting the knitted sweater while fixing the knitted sweater, the knitted sweater is prevented from deforming in the ironing process, then the ironing component is operated to iron and shape the knitted sweater model, and the stability of the knitted sweater during ironing is improved.
Preferably, the fixed support component comprises a limiting block, a rotating shaft, a connecting plate, a first supporting rod, a second supporting rod, a groove, a bidirectional cylinder, a shaft pin and a sliding component, wherein two groups of rotating shafts are arranged at the top end of the ironing table, the limiting block is respectively arranged at the top ends of the two groups of rotating shafts, the two groups of rotating shafts are respectively connected with the two groups of connecting plates in a rotating way, the first supporting rods are respectively arranged at the rear ends of the two groups of connecting plates, the second supporting rods are respectively arranged at the rear ends of the two groups of first supporting rods, the groove is formed in the top end of the ironing table, the sliding component is arranged in the groove, the bidirectional cylinder is arranged on the sliding component, and the two groups of moving ends of the bidirectional cylinder are respectively hinged with the inner ends of the two groups of connecting plates through the shaft pin; when the knitted sweater is sleeved, a worker operates the bidirectional cylinder to stretch, so that the front ends of the two groups of connecting plates are mirror-imaged and kept away under the cooperation of the rotating shafts, the rear ends of the two groups of connecting plates drive the corresponding first supporting rods and the second supporting rods to mirror and approach, the knitted sweater is sleeved on the outer sides of the first supporting rods and the second supporting rods, and then the bidirectional cylinder is operated to shorten, so that the inner sides of the knitted sweater are fixed and tightly supported by the cooperation of the first supporting rods and the second supporting rods, and the firmness is improved.
Preferably, the pressing ironing assembly comprises upright posts, a cross beam, a servo motor, a screw rod, a moving plate, electric hydraulic cylinders and a lifting plate, wherein two groups of upright posts are arranged at the top end of the ironing table, the top ends of the two groups of upright posts are connected with the bottom end of the cross beam, an opening is formed in the cross beam, the right end of the cross beam is provided with the servo motor, the screw rod is rotatably arranged in the opening, the right end of the screw rod is connected with the output end of the servo motor, the moving plate is slidably mounted in the opening, the moving plate is assembled with the screw rod in a threaded manner, two groups of electric hydraulic cylinders are arranged at the top end of the moving plate, the bottom moving ends of the two groups of electric hydraulic cylinders extend to the lower part of the moving plate and are connected with the top end of the lifting plate, and ironing rollers are arranged at the bottom end of the lifting plate; when ironing is needed, a worker operates the electric hydraulic cylinder to extend, so that the lifting plate drives the ironing roller to descend, the ironing roller contacts with the top end of the knitted sweater, and then the servo motor is started, so that the screw rod is adjusted to the left and right positions in the opening, and the ironing roller presses and irones the knitted sweater, and ironing efficiency is improved.
Preferably, the sliding component comprises a feed rod and a moving block, wherein the feed rod is fixedly arranged in the groove, the moving block is arranged in the groove in a sliding manner, the moving block is in sliding connection with the feed rod, and the top end of the moving block is provided with a bidirectional cylinder; when the bidirectional cylinder stretches and shortens, the bidirectional cylinder slides in a front-back position adaptive manner under the cooperation of the moving block and the light bar, so that the flexibility is improved.
Preferably, the support leg further comprises a base, wherein the base is arranged at the bottom end of the support leg; the base and the supporting legs are matched with each other to stably support the ironing table.
Preferably, the ironing machine also comprises guide rods, wherein the rear ends of the two groups of second support rods are respectively provided with the guide rods, and the guide rods and the top end of the ironing table are arranged at an acute angle; the guide rod is arranged at an acute angle with the top end of the ironing table, so that the knitted sweater is quickly sleeved on the two groups of first supporting rods and the two groups of second supporting rods, and convenience is improved.
Preferably, a sliding rod is arranged in the opening, and the moving plate is in sliding connection with the sliding rod; the moving plate slides in a stable left-right position under the cooperation of the sliding rod.
Compared with the prior art, the utility model has the beneficial effects that: when the ironing device is used, the knitted sweater is sleeved on the fixed supporting component, the fixed supporting component is used for supporting the knitted sweater while fixing the knitted sweater, the knitted sweater is prevented from deforming in the ironing process, then the ironing component is operated to iron and shape the knitted sweater model, and the stability of the knitted sweater during ironing is improved.

Examples
As shown in fig. 1 and 4, the sweater pressing and ironing device comprises an ironing table 1 and supporting legs 2, wherein the supporting legs 2 are arranged at the bottom end of the ironing table 1, and the sweater pressing and ironing device further comprises a fixed supporting component and a pressing and ironing component, wherein the fixed supporting component and the pressing and ironing component are both arranged at the top end of the ironing table 1, the fixed supporting component supports and fixes the sweater from the inside of the sweater, and the pressing and ironing component presses and shapes the sweater;
as shown in fig. 1, fig. 2, fig. 3, fig. 4 and fig. 5, the fixed support assembly comprises a limiting block 3, a rotating shaft 4, a connecting plate 5, a first support rod 6, a second support rod 7, a groove 8, a bidirectional cylinder 9, a shaft pin 10 and a sliding assembly, two groups of rotating shafts 4 are arranged at the top end of the ironing table 1, the limiting block 3 is respectively arranged at the top end of the two groups of rotating shafts 4, the two groups of rotating shafts 4 are respectively connected with the two groups of connecting plates 5 in a rotating manner, the rear ends of the two groups of connecting plates 5 are respectively provided with the first support rod 6, the rear ends of the two groups of the first support rods 6 are respectively provided with the second support rod 7, the top end of the ironing table 1 is provided with the groove 8, the sliding assembly is arranged in the groove 8, and the bidirectional cylinder 9 is arranged on the sliding assembly, and two groups of moving ends of the bidirectional cylinder 9 are respectively hinged with the inner ends of the two groups of connecting plates 5 through the shaft pin 10.
In this embodiment, when the sweater is sleeved, the worker operates the bidirectional cylinder 9 to extend, so that the front ends of the two groups of connecting plates 5 are mirror-imaged and kept away under the cooperation of the rotating shaft 4, so that the rear ends of the two groups of connecting plates 5 drive the corresponding first support rods 6 and second support rods 7 to mirror-image and approach, then the sweater is sleeved on the outer sides of the two groups of first support rods 6 and the two groups of second support rods 7, and then the bidirectional cylinder 9 is operated to shorten, so that the two groups of first support rods 6 and the two groups of second support rods 7 cooperate to fix and tighten the sweater from the inner side of the sweater, and then the ironing assembly is operated to iron and shape the sweater model, so that the stability of the sweater is improved when ironing.
